Key Responsibilities of Cheese Packer Jobs in UK with Visa Sponsorship:

  • Packaging: Wrap and get cheese ready, making sure it looks good and is clean.
  • Quality Control: Check cheese products to make sure they are safe and of good quality.
  • Labeling: Make sure that products are labeled correctly with expiration dates, batch numbers, and other important information.
  • Inventory Management: Keep an eye on your stock levels and let someone know if there are any problems.
  • Sanitation: Keep the workplace clean and safe by following hygiene rules.
  • Teamwork: Work together with others to reach production objectives and keep the business running smoothly.

  1. What does a cheese packer do?

    Using packing equipment, fills cheese wheel molds with cheese curd and keeps an eye on the size of the cheese wheels. Puts wheels on cheese presses in a horizontal stack.

  2. What is a packager’s qualification?

    To be a packager, you need to have a high school graduation or GED and some experience working in a factory or warehouse. You need to be strong and have a lot of energy to lift and move heavy things.
